linuxmysql命令不支持

worktile 其他 16

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Linux中的MySQL命令不支持的可能原因有以下几种:

    1. 未正确安装MySQL:如果你在Linux系统上安装了MySQL,但是无法使用相应的命令,可能是因为MySQL没有正确安装。你可以通过检查MySQL的安装路径、启动服务和查看日志文件来确定是否正确安装。

    2. 环境变量设置问题:在Linux系统中,执行命令时会从环境变量中查找命令所在的路径。如果MySQL命令没有被正确设置到环境变量中,就无法通过命令行执行。你可以通过编辑文件`.bashrc`或`.bash_profile`来设置环境变量。

    3. 权限问题:在Linux系统上,一些MySQL命令可能需要管理员权限才能执行。如果你没有足够的权限,就无法使用这些命令。你可以尝试使用`sudo`命令来以管理员身份执行MySQL命令。

    4. MySQL版本不兼容:某些MySQL命令可能只在特定版本的MySQL中有效。如果你使用的是较新或较旧的MySQL版本,并且命令不支持该版本,就会出现无法使用的情况。你可以查阅MySQL的官方文档或更新软件以解决兼容性问题。

    总结起来,如果你在Linux系统上无法使用MySQL命令,首先要检查MySQL的安装情况、环境变量设置、权限以及版本兼容性等因素。通过解决这些问题,你应该能够成功使用MySQL命令。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    很抱歉,题目描述有误。Linux系统是支持MySQL数据库的,并提供了许多与MySQL相关的命令和工具。以下是关于在Linux上使用MySQL的一些常用命令和操作。

    1. 安装MySQL:在Linux上安装MySQL数据库是非常简单的。可以使用包管理工具如apt、yum、zypper等,输入相应的命令来安装MySQL服务器和客户端软件。

    2. 启动和停止MySQL服务:在大部分Linux发行版中,MySQL作为一个服务来运行。可以使用systemd来启动、停止和重启MySQL服务。例如,通过以下命令来启动MySQL服务:
    “`
    sudo systemctl start mysql
    “`
    停止MySQL服务:
    “`
    sudo systemctl stop mysql
    “`
    重启MySQL服务:
    “`
    sudo systemctl restart mysql
    “`

    3. 登录到MySQL服务器:在安装好MySQL后,可以使用以下命令登录到MySQL服务器:
    “`
    mysql -u 用户名 -p
    “`
    其中,用户名是指MySQL服务器中的用户名称。然后输入密码即可登录。

    4. 创建和管理数据库:在登录到MySQL服务器后,可以使用以下命令来创建和管理数据库:
    创建数据库:
    “`
    CREATE DATABASE 数据库名;
    “`
    删除数据库:
    “`
    DROP DATABASE 数据库名;
    “`
    显示数据库列表:
    “`
    SHOW DATABASES;
    “`

    5. 创建和管理数据表:在数据库中,可以使用以下命令来创建和管理数据表:
    创建表:
    “`
    CREATE TABLE 表名 (
    列名1 数据类型,
    列名2 数据类型,

    );
    “`
    修改表结构:
    “`
    ALTER TABLE 表名 ADD COLUMN 列名 数据类型;
    “`
    删除表:
    “`
    DROP TABLE 表名;
    “`
    显示表结构:
    “`
    DESCRIBE 表名;
    “`

    以上是关于在Linux上使用MySQL的一些常用命令和操作,还有许多其他的命令和功能可以用于管理和操作MySQL数据库。希望对你有所帮助!

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    如果您在Linux系统中使用mysql命令时遇到了不支持的问题,可能是由于以下原因:

    1. 未安装MySQL数据库:在Linux系统中,默认情况下是不会安装MySQL数据库的。您需要通过终端使用包管理器(如apt、yum等)来安装MySQL。

    2. 未添加MySQL命令到环境变量:即使您已经安装了MySQL,也需要将其添加到系统的环境变量中,以便在任何目录下都可以使用mysql命令。您可以编辑个人或系统级别的bash配置文件,将MySQL的安装路径添加到PATH变量中。

    3. 安装问题或版本不匹配:如果您已经成功安装了MySQL,但仍然无法使用mysql命令,可能是由于安装过程中出现了一些问题,或者是您使用的mysql版本与系统不兼容。您可以尝试重新安装MySQL或查找与系统版本相匹配的MySQL版本。

    4. 语法错误或命令错误:有时候出现不支持mysql命令的问题可能是因为您输入的命令有语法错误或者拼写错误。请确保正确输入mysql命令的语法,以及输入的命令名称和参数是正确的。

    为了解决上述问题,可以按照以下步骤进行操作:

    步骤1:安装MySQL
    在终端中使用适用于您的Linux发行版的包管理器(如apt、yum等)来安装MySQL。具体命令如下:

    对于Debian/Ubuntu系统:
    sudo apt-get install mysql-server

    对于CentOS/RHEL系统:
    sudo yum install mysql-server

    步骤2:添加MySQL到环境变量
    打开终端并编辑bash配置文件(~/.bashrc或/etc/bash.bashrc),将MySQL安装路径添加到PATH变量中。具体命令如下:

    打开个人级别的配置文件:
    sudo nano ~/.bashrc

    在文件末尾添加以下行:
    export PATH=$PATH:/usr/local/mysql/bin

    保存并关闭文件,并重新加载bash配置文件:
    source ~/.bashrc

    步骤3:验证安装和环境变量
    在终端中输入以下命令验证MySQL是否正确安装和环境变量是否设置正确:

    mysql –version

    应该显示MySQL的版本号。

    步骤4:检查语法和命令
    确保您输入的mysql命令的语法正确,以及命令名称和参数正确。可以查阅MySQL官方文档以获取正确的命令。

    通过按tab键自动补全命令可以减少语法和拼写错误的可能性。

    如果您仍然遇到不支持mysql命令的问题,可能需要尝试重新安装MySQL,或者查找与您的系统版本和配置相匹配的MySQL版本,并确保正确设置了环境变量。

    总结起来,要解决不支持mysql命令的问题,需要先安装MySQL数据库,然后将其添加到环境变量中,确保输入的命令语法正确,并注意与系统版本和配置的兼容性。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部